Downunder Charters

What could be better than spending time deep sea fishing? Nothing!! Downunder Charters offers you a chance to get out into the ocean and test your skill against the fish. We cater for all levels of experience from beginner to experienced and children over 5 are welcome too. We provide everything you need to catch fish, quality rods and reels, bait and lures. We have 28 years worth of GPS marks so we know where the fish are likely to be. Our vessel "Downunder" is a wide body Shark Cat, 9.85m long and 4.8m wide, meaning she is extremely stable in the water giving a safe and secure ride. With a solid roof over the entire rear deck and seats all round there is plenty of room to fish in comfort. She is currently registered in 2C survey and capable of carrying 12 passengers and 3 crew. She carries a full complement of safety equipment including a 16 man SOLAS liferaft and her crew are all fully qualified with the Australian Maritime Safety Authority. Our charters run for either 6 or 8 hours and you get to keep any fish you catch (subject to State bag/ size and species restrictions). Tweed Eco Cruises

TWEED Eco Cruises is privileged to have its roots deeply embedded in a region the rest of our nation refers to as Australia's holiday playground. TEC, a second-generation family-owned and operated concern, is fully staffed by proud long-term Tweed and southern Gold Coast residents who are committed to promoting the region known as The Green Cauldron. Spruiking the NSW Northern Rivers' many assets is as easy as it is natural... An area with a surf-laden coastline, nestled between international tourism drawcards Byron Bay and the Gold Coast and boasting 10 national parks on its western perimeter. Ecological delights are at every turn in a sub-tropical region laced with rainforests and loaded with fertile lands from its 23 million-year volcanic history... And all under the imposing gaze of Wollumbin (Mt Warning), the first place in Australia to welcome the morning sun! TEC proudly operates on the resource-rich Tweed River, a 78 km waterway with a highly-valued and respected influence.
